Sicon landed costs have been rewritten without the requirement to use Sage landed cost postings.
A new landed cost maintenance screen has been created, to allow for additional landed costs types to be created. An apportionment type and apportionment method can be set.
A new option to allow for landed costs to be split over multiple PO receipts against a single purchase order has been created.
When Sicon distribution containers is installed, landed costs can be set at the container level.
A migration routine will run when upgrading a site that is already using Sicon landed costs.
The set up required for new landed costs is detailed in the distribution POP management HUG.
Issues Resolved
- [#13328] New sales contract order history entries will now have the correct sales order number for quotes.
- [#15946] When selecting a contract for a sales order line, the initial quantity ordered is now displayed.
- [#16063] Sales order forecasting numeric item codes, item names, and warehouse names are no longer formatted as decimals.
- [#16670] Correct quantities are passed through when receiving a container. Issue where the traceable selection form was displayed when receiving 0.
- [#16674] Adding historical items to a PO or copy and paste items with a default container set will now be entered into the container.
- [#17689] Fix when using the ‘Copy and Paste’ feature on SOP and selecting a different delivery address via the ‘Customer Details popup’ feature and then saving the sales order. [“Cannot insert duplicate key row in object ‘dbo.SOPDocDelAddress’ with unique index ‘IX_SOPDocDelAddress_SOPOrderReturnID'”].
- [#16614] Fix to ensure we set the quantity field when adding a new ‘Requested Delivery Date’ to a purchase order when using the ‘Update PO Lines’ from PO tracking.
